Output 581f9bd1d9b48faf248859e768204c84006bd6dc156ee4b97559bb193aeb9918:27

value
19173026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e4a219c4c7d957ca06a96b24ebcb9829e359a66 OP_EQUAL
address
MF37k8DzvDp5zXgBK4EiW4nRMztZdNEE5a
transaction
581f9bd1d9b48faf248859e768204c84006bd6dc156ee4b97559bb193aeb9918
spent
true